An investigation of the Al-Rh-Ru phase diagram above 50 at.% Al

Partial 1100,1000,900 and 700 °C isothermal sections of the Al-Rh-Ru phase diagram were determined. The isostructural binary AlRu and AlRh phases probably form a continuous B-range of the CsCl-type solid solutions. The Al_9Rh_2 and C-Al_5Rh_2 dissolve up to 4.5 and 13 at.% Ru, while Al_(13)Ru_4 and Al_2Ru dissolve up to 14.5 and 8 at.% Rh, respectively. A ternary orthorhombic structure (Pbma, a = 2.34, b = 1.62 and c = 2.00 nm) related to the Al-Rh e-phases was revealed at the extension of the Al-Rh e-phase area at compositions up to Al_77Rh_(15)Ru_8.
